CAD versions is usually saved from the stereolithography file structure (STL), a de facto CAD file structure for additive manufacturing that merchants facts dependant on triangulations of CAD models. STL is just not tailor-made for additive manufacturing as it generates significant file dimensions of topology optimized pieces and lattice constructions as a result of huge quantity of surfaces concerned.

SLS and DMLS are successfully precisely the same system, merging the particles in the fabric, with out attaining a complete melt. SLS is utilized to explain the sintering procedure when placed on non-metal materials, with DMLS useful for steel.

Photopolymerization is largely Employed in stereolithography to generate a solid component from the liquid. Inkjet printer programs like the Objet PolyJet procedure spray photopolymer products onto a Develop tray in ultra-slender layers (in between sixteen and thirty µm) until the element is done. Every photopolymer layer is cured with UV light-weight soon after it really is jetted, manufacturing completely cured types that may be dealt with and utilized instantly, with out post-curing.
